Site Manager – Steel Frame Construction Project
Location: Hemel Hempstead Sector: Construction / Self-Storage Warehouse Development
This Site Manager is required to support the delivery of a self-storage warehouse development in Hemel Hempstead. The role involves assisting the Project Manager in overseeing day-to-day site operations on a steel frame construction project, ensuring works are completed safely, on programme, and to the highest standard.
Key Responsibilities
- Support the Project Manager in managing all on-site construction activities
- Supervise and coordinate subcontractors, with a strong focus on steel frame erection and associated trades
- Monitor progress against programme and assist in driving works to meet key milestones
- Enforce strict health & safety standards, in compliance with CDM regulations
- Carry out site inductions, toolbox talks, and daily briefings
- Ensure quality control through regular inspections and snagging processes
- Assist with managing site documentation, including:
- Risk Assessment & Method Statements (RAMS)
- Permits to work
- Daily site reports
- Coordinate:
- Site logistics
- Deliveries
- Material storage
- Maintain clear communication with subcontractors, suppliers, and the wider project team

Requirements
- Proven experience as a Site Manager or Site Supervisor within construction
- Strong background working on steel frame/structural steel projects (essential)
- Experience on industrial, warehouse, or self-storage builds (highly desirable)
- Solid understanding of:
- Construction sequencing
- Site logistics
- Programme management
- SMSTS or SSSTS certification
- Valid CSCS card
- First Aid qualification (preferred)
